Modernizing a live marketplace
TCGplayer’s customer-facing marketplace was a large, monolithic application built primarily for desktop use. Many pages still relied on rigid, table-based layouts that were difficult to adapt to smaller screens.
The company had explored full redesigns with outside agencies, but putting those concepts into production remained a challenge. A complete redesign would have required coordinating changes across a large number of pages, systems, and teams while keeping the marketplace running.
We had ideas for where the product should go. What we needed was a manageable way to get there.
02 / RESPONSIVE STRATEGY
A more practical approach to responsive design

During a one-week internal hackathon, I explored whether we could separate mobile support from the larger visual redesign.
Rather than redesigning every page before development could begin, I kept the existing appearance largely intact and rebuilt the underlying layouts to be responsive. This gave us a simpler path:
- Make the existing marketplace usable across screen sizes
- Improve individual pages and features over time
- Avoid tying mobile support to one large redesign and launch
By the end of the week, I had created a working prototype covering roughly 90% of the customer-facing page types.
The prototype gave the team a concrete alternative to rebuilding everything at once. TCGplayer could create a responsive foundation first, then modernize the visual experience in smaller, more manageable pieces.

Adapting dense marketplace information
Making the marketplace responsive involved more than shrinking a desktop page.
Product names, card conditions, sellers, prices, quantities, filters, and purchasing controls all competed for space. On smaller screens, I needed to decide what customers should see immediately, what could move elsewhere, and how purchasing interactions could change without becoming unfamiliar.
Those decisions also had to work across many different page types. The prototype needed to demonstrate a reusable approach rather than solve only a few carefully selected screens.
The result was a realistic modernization strategy for the existing marketplace—one that improved mobile usability while leaving room for the visual design to evolve separately.

An in-store catalog for local game stores

Another major project I worked on at TCGplayer was an in-store catalog and ordering kiosk for local game stores.
Stores could have far more cards in stock than they could reasonably display. Customers often browsed display cases or dense binders, then asked an employee whether particular cards were available.
The kiosk gave customers a way to search the store’s broader inventory themselves. They could:
- Search and browse available cards
- Review product details and pricing
- Add items to a cart
- Create an order for the store to fulfill
It brought the convenience of the store’s online catalog into the physical shopping experience. Customers could browse at their own pace, and employees no longer needed to guide every inventory search personally.
05 / KIOSK WORKFLOW
Designing around the in-store workflow
I worked on the kiosk from the initial wireframes and customer flows through product stories, interface design, and frontend development.
The experience needed to make sense without training. Search, availability, product details, cart management, and order creation all had to be clear to someone walking up to the kiosk for the first time.
It also needed to fit into tools retailers already used. I worked with the API team on the inventory and ordering services, then connected the kiosk’s configuration to the existing retailer account portal.
The final experience was designed specifically for someone shopping inside the store, with fewer distractions and a clearer path from searching the catalog to submitting an order.

Launching storefronts for more than 600 retailers

Another major project was creating a hosted storefront platform for TCGplayer retailers.
Most participating stores already maintained their inventory in TCGplayer. The opportunity was to turn that existing data into a complete customer-facing website without asking each retailer to build or populate one themselves.
I created a system of more than 20 storefront templates that stores could choose from. Launching a site required little more than uploading logos and replacing a few pieces of placeholder content. Banner artwork was provided, while product inventory, card details, and card imagery were populated from TCGplayer through its APIs.
The challenge was providing enough variety for each store to have a distinct presence while keeping hundreds of sites practical to launch and maintain. The templates shared a reusable foundation but offered different layouts and visual treatments, all built to work with the same retailer data.
The platform ultimately supported more than 600 retailer websites hosted through Umbraco Cloud. It gave stores a usable ecommerce presence with very little setup while allowing TCGplayer to operate the entire network through a shared system.
